Output d58b3e5d148718148231ded7f239cdfae63c65bb38f57d109d9397bc2e4d0d49:8

value
1930975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ac66f7ca0e294c261eb13b8317c7bbc1d178c6e OP_EQUAL
address
348bD5633BkrZ86JT9oxPgud61nPU6enYF
transaction
d58b3e5d148718148231ded7f239cdfae63c65bb38f57d109d9397bc2e4d0d49
spent
true